About the project

The IGNITE Doctoral Landscape Award is offering to fund PhDs in the natural and environmental sciences.

Studying through the Doctoral Landscape Award means you’ll benefit from:

  • a bespoke training programme to support your skills development in areas including digital and data skills, science communication, and leadership and innovation.
  • the opportunity to go on two funded placements
  • a Research Training Support Grant to enable you to attend conferences and undertake training
  • access to world-class facilities and expertise across our academic and industry partners

You can apply to an advertised project or propose your own.

About the IGNITE Doctoral Landscape Award

The IGNITE Doctoral Landscape Award is a collaboration with four research organisations: 

  • British Antarctic Survey
  • National Oceanography Centre
  • Marine Biological Association
  • Natural History Museum.
